The catalytic converter can make a rattling sound if the heat shield is loose, is clogged, or has been damaged. Every catalytic converter features a heat shield to protect the vehicle’s floor from the intense temperatures generated by the converter. The catalytic converter’s heat shield protects the cab floor and surrounding ground cover from potential combustion by the 1,200°f to 1,600°f heat generated in the converter.
